Yuzhmash regrets rumours about plant's alleged backing of Russia's nuclear potential

Yuzhmash (Pivdenmash, Dnipro) has expressed regret about rumours about its alleged involvement in supporting Russia's nuclear potential, in particular, production and servicing of Topol-M intercontinental ballistic missiles, the press service of the enterprise has reported.

"On July 3 a person who named himself a military expert appeared on Ukrainian TV and said that Yuzhmash, as the manufacturer of the Topol-M intercontinental ballistic missiles, biannually carries out maintenance and that the enterprise sent 14 intercontinental ballistic missiles to Russia in May 2017," the press service of Yuzhmash said.

The press service said that Yuzhmash is not the manufacturer of Topol-M intercontinental ballistic missiles. The enterprise has not produced any strategic missiles since Indepdence and has no missiles in stock.

"The information that Yuzhmash transferred intercontinental ballistic missiles is untrue," the enterprise said.
